Saul is now paul
Pause for a moment, and let this sink in.
There was a man named Saul. His footsteps carried fear. His shadow left wounds. Families prayed he would pass their homes by. Mothers cried themselves to sleep because husbands had been dragged away. Children screamed as their fathers were chained and taken to prison. Entire gatherings of believers scattered in fear when his name was mentioned.
And here is the painful truth Saul thought he was serving God. He thought his hatred was holy. He thought his violence was righteous. But he was blind. Blind to grace. Blind to truth. Blind to the very Jesus he thought he was defending.
My friend, let me speak to your heart as you read this: how many times have you, too, thought you were right, only to discover you were hurting the very God you claimed to serve? How many times have your choices, your pride, your silence, or your anger left someone else broken? Doesn’t it sting to admit it? I, Duke Barnabas, have felt that sting. And maybe as you read this, you feel it too.
Then came Damascus. Saul, proud and strong, marching with letters of authority, ready to spill more blood. But heaven interrupted. A light brighter than the sun knocked him flat. Dust filled his mouth. His eyes burned in blindness. And then,those words.
“Saul, Saul, why are you persecuting Me?”
Let that echo in your soul. Replace Saul’s name with your own. “Why are you fighting Me? Why are you resisting Me? Why are you breaking My heart?”
Can you feel it? Saul’s strength melted into weakness. The mighty persecutor lay trembling in the dust. The one who dragged others by force now had to be led by the hand like a child. Helpless. Blind. Broken.
And here comes the most painful yet beautiful part.Jesus should have crushed him. He deserved judgment. But instead, He received mercy. The very Christ Saul hated called him chosen. The enemy of the church was embraced as God’s instrument. The murderer became a messenger.
Now let me speak straight into your heart: this is not just Saul’s story,it is yours. Your guilt, your past, your shame may scream at you. Your failures may rise like giants before you. You may feel unworthy, filthy, disqualified. But the same mercy that met Saul on that dusty road is reaching for you right now.
Yes,you. With all your scars. With all your sins. With all your regrets. The voice of Jesus is whispering your name as you read this.
Don’t harden your heart. Let the tears come. Let the weight of His love break you. Because the same God who turned Saul into Paul is calling you into a new story.
Your Damascus road might be this very moment. And in your brokenness, He is saying: “I still want you. I still choose you. Your story is not over.”

The Vendors of the Vineyard.
Shepherds are now recruited like Uber drivers.
Open your phone. Scroll through any Celestial Church of Christ social media group. You'll find it: "Parish needs shepherd. DM for details." Not from the church office. From vendors,private scouts who broker clergy placements like they're selling secondhand cars.
This is not evolution. This is institutional death, and the administration is either asleep, scared, or complicit.
A shepherd who submits his "CV" to a Facebook scout has surrendered his calling to the highest bidder. He is no longer sent by the church,he is sold by a middleman. The parish that receives him through this backdoor owes the mother body nothing. The landlord churches know this. That's why they love it.
The transfer letter,the document that once meant the church knew you, tested you, and covered you,has been replaced by a private chat and a handshake. And the office responsible for transfers? Silent. Utterly, deafeningly silent.
Why the Silence?Three possibilities. None flattering.
One: They don't know. Which means they're incompetent and should not be trusted with church keys, let alone clergy administration.
Two: They know but are afraid. Afraid of the landlord churches. Afraid of the vendors. Afraid of their own shadows. Cowardice in leadership is worse than ignorance,it enables the rot.
Three: They benefit. We won't speculate. But when a system this broken persists without correction, the faithful are entitled to ask: who profits from the chaos
To every prophet, shepherd, and assistant shepherd who packed your bags and moved to a parish without the office's knowledge: you are on your own.
Not as punishment. As fact. When the parish turns on you and parishes always turn who will defend you? The vendor who placed you? They'll block your number. The church office you bypassed? You told them they were irrelevant. They heard you.You wanted freedom from structure. You got isolation without protection. Congratulations.
Stop waiting for the office to wake up. Make noise. Every parish using vendors should be named. Every clergy member placed through backchannels should be questioned. Every administrator who sees this and stays quiet should be asked: What is your job, exactly?
The Celestial Church of Christ does not belong to online marketers. It does not belong to vendors ,
It belongs to the faithful. And the faithful are tired.
Work on your administration. Or watch your administration work on nothing while the church becomes a marketplace.

THE SHEPHERD'S SEAT: Why Your Anointing Does Not Give You His Chair
A dangerous message for Assistant Shepherds, Church Prophets, Evangelists and "Next-in-Line" Ministers in Celestial Church of Christ.
Some of you are not serving your shepherd anymore. You are studying him like a man preparing for a takeover.
Yes. Let's begin there.
You call it "concern for the church." Heaven calls it ambition mixed with pride.
You notice every weakness. Every forgotten hymn. Every wrong administrative decision. Every time he struggles to speak English. Every time the congregation responds more to your ministration than his.And secretly… you enjoy it.
The dangerous thing is not that you are gifted. The dangerous thing is that your gift has started convincing you that you are the real shepherd while the actual shepherd is only occupying space.
That spirit has destroyed more prophets than immorality ever did.
Let us stop pretending.Some assistant shepherds, church prophet and evangelist are not assisting anymore. They are campaigning silently.Some prophets no longer prophesy to edify the church. They prophesy to prove they are deeper than the shepherd.
Some evangelists no longer win souls for Christ. They win loyalty for themselves.The church members say: "If not for that assistant shepherd, this parish would collapse."And instead of killing those words, you feed on them like hidden manna from hell.
You smile humbly outside, but inside your spirit says: "Maybe they are right."That was how Lucifer fell. Not through fornication. Not through stealing. Through comparison.
YOU PREACH BETTER… SO WHAT?
You preach with fire. People scream. Women cry. Young people travel from other parishes to hear you. Meanwhile your shepherd speaks slowly, repeats points, and sometimes struggles with modern things.
And because of that, you have started reducing him in your heart.But hear this painful truth:The fact that David could kill Goliath did not make him king while Saul was still on the throne.Gift is not government. Anointing is not authority. Revelation is not leadership.
You may carry fresh oil and still be under an older mantle.
THE MOST DANGEROUS SENTENCE IN CCC TODAY
"Daddy is trying… but honestly, na we dey run the church."That sentence has buried destinies.
Because the moment you start believing the church survives because of you, humility has already left your altar.
Listen carefully:The church existed before you arrived. It will continue after you leave.God can replace a prophet overnight. He can empty a gifted evangelist in one season. He can remove a dreamer and raise a stammerer.
Ask Nebuchadnezzar. One moment he was speaking with pride. The next moment he was eating grass.
FAMILIARITY IS EATING MANY MINISTERS ALIVE
You have entered the shepherd's bedroom. You know his family problems. You know the financial struggles of the parish. You have seen him weak, tired, confused, even frustrated.And now you no longer see him as "God's servant." You see him as "just a man."
That is how honor dies.
The tragedy of familiarity is this: The closer some people get to grace, the less they value it.
You now correct him carelessly in meetings. You challenge him before elders. You release "deep revelations" that indirectly expose him.And you call it maturity.No. It is pride wearing white garments.
Let us be brutally honest.Some prophets cannot stay under authority for long because they are addicted to visibility.You don't just want ministry. You want control.
You don't just want souls saved. You want your own congregation shouting your name.
You don't just want to serve. You want people standing when you enter.
So every instruction from your shepherd now irritates your ego because your heart secretly believes: "I have outgrown this place."Dangerous spirit.Because many people who "outgrew" their shepherd ended up growing out of grace too.
THE CURSE OF OUTSHINING YOUR COVERING
There is a mystery many young ministers do not understand:When your shepherd's embarrassment becomes your secret satisfaction, heaven starts resisting you.Some of you enjoy when members compare you to your shepherd.
You enjoy comments like:
"You are wiser than Daddy."
"You are more spiritual."
"If you leave this parish, many people will follow you."
And instead of rebuking those words, you preserve them in your heart like prophecy.
But hear me carefully:The day you begin to compete with the man covering you spiritually, you have already started digging your own pit.Even Absalom stole hearts before he stole the throne.And we know how he ended.
A PROPHECY TO ASSISTANT SHEPHERDS, PROPHETS & EVANGELISTS
If you cannot genuinely celebrate another man's authority, your own authority will become a burden when it finally comes.Because one day, you too will sit where your shepherd sits now.You will discover that leadership is heavier than it looks from the second row.
You will realize that the same assistant you are raising may one day look at you the same way you looked at your shepherd.
Then you will understand why Moses became angry. Why Elijah became tired. Why even Jesus had Judas close to Him.
DON'T LET YOUR GIFT DESTROY YOU
In Celestial Church today, many people are full of visions but empty of submission.We have prophets who can see tomorrow but cannot obey today.
Evangelists who can fill crusades but cannot sit quietly under correction.
Assistant shepherds who know administration but do not know loyalty.
And heaven is watching.
Be careful that your gift does not become the knife that cuts off your own destiny.Because in this kingdom, God does not only test power. He tests posture.Not everybody who carries fire can carry a throne.
So tell me:Can you truly serve under a shepherd who is less educated than you… less gifted than you… less charismatic than you… and still honor him without bitterness?
That answer may reveal more about your spiritual maturity than all your prophecies combined.
